Gamma analysis dependence on specified low‐dose thresholds for VMAT QA

Abstract: The American Association of Physicists in Medicine Task Group 119 instructed institutions to use a low‐dose threshold of 10% or a region of interest determined by the jaw setting when they collected gamma analysis quality assurance (QA) data for the planar dose distribution. However, there are no clinical data to quantitatively demonstrate the impact of the low‐dose threshold on the gamma index. Therefore, we performed a gamma analysis with various low‐dose thresholds in the range of 0% to 15% according to bot… Show more

“…The %GP does not seem to depend on the low-dose threshold values irrespective of the gamma criteria used. This is because the normalisation of dose difference in improved gamma calculation was with the maximum reference dose which is relatively higher than the dose difference in the low-dose region 17 . The SD values increase by increasing the threshold and tightening the acceptance criteria from 3%/3 mm to 1%/1 mm.…”

“…As the threshold increases from 0 to 15%, the mean %GP increases by 13, 27 and 47% for the 3%/3 mm, 2%/2 mm and 1%/1 mm criteria, respectively. This is due to the fact that the dose difference is normalised to the currently evaluated pixel for local gamma calculation and therefore, the pixels in low-dose regions usually fail the acceptance criteria 17 . After a threshold of 10%, the %GP does not seem to depend on threshold irrespective of the gamma criteria used.…”
